What Do UK Employment Solicitors Do?

UK employment solicitors are legal experts who advise and represent both employers and employees on a wide range of employment law issues They provide valuable guidance on areas such as employment contracts, discrimination, unfair dismissal, redundancy, and employee rights Whether you are a small business owner dealing with an employment dispute or an employee seeking legal assistance, an employment solicitor can help you understand your rights and responsibilities under the law.

Employment solicitors work with clients to understand their unique situations and provide tailored advice to help them achieve the best possible outcome They may assist with drafting employment contracts, negotiating settlement agreements, representing clients in employment tribunals, and providing guidance on compliance with employment laws and regulations In essence, employment solicitors act as legal advocates, working to protect the rights and interests of their clients in the workplace.

The Importance of UK Employment Solicitors

UK employment law is constantly evolving, with new legislation and case law setting precedent on a regular basis Navigating this intricate legal framework can be challenging, especially for those without a legal background Employment solicitors play a crucial role in providing clarity and guidance in this complex landscape, ensuring that employers and employees understand their rights and obligations under the law.

For employers, employment solicitors can help minimize the risk of legal disputes and ensure compliance with employment laws By seeking legal advice early on, employers can avoid costly litigation and protect their businesses from potential legal liabilities Employment solicitors can also assist with drafting employment policies, handling disciplinary matters, and resolving disputes in a timely and efficient manner.

For employees, employment solicitors can provide valuable support and representation in cases of unfair treatment, discrimination, or wrongful dismissal These legal professionals can help employees understand their rights, negotiate fair settlements, and represent them in legal proceedings if necessary Having an experienced employment solicitor on their side can significantly improve the chances of a successful outcome for employees facing workplace disputes.
